Household of Claude George Bowes-Lyon 14th Earl of Strathmore and Kinghorne

He is married to Cecilia Nina Cavendish Bentinck.

They got married on July 16, 1881 at Surrey, England, he was 26 years old.Source 8


Child(ren):

  1. Fergus Bowes Lyon  1889-1915
  2. George Bowes Lyon  1895-1952
  3. David Bowes Lyon  1902-1961
